LED Circuit Board Indicator 5652F1-5V Equivalent & Substitute Parts
Part Overview
The 5652F1-5V is a 3mm red LED circuit board indicator manufactured by Visual Communications Company (VCC) in the 5650 series. This component is designed for through-hole, right-angle mounting applications requiring a 5V single red diffused indicator with 13mA operating current and 8mcd brightness output.
The 5652F1-5V is classified as obsolete. Identifying equivalent and substitute parts is necessary to maintain design continuity, ensure supply chain availability, and support ongoing production or maintenance requirements for systems utilizing this component.

Key Parameters
| Parameter | Value |
|---|---|
| Manufacturer Part Number | 5652F1-5V |
| Manufacturer | Visual Communications Company (VCC) |
| Product Status | Obsolete |
| Color | Red |
| Wavelength - Peak | 655nm |
| Configuration | Single |
| Voltage Rating | 5V |
| Current | 13mA |
| Millicandela Rating | 8mcd |
| Lens Type | Diffused, Tinted |
| Lens Style | Round with Domed Top |
| Lens Size | 3mm, T-1 |
| Mounting Type | Through Hole, Right Angle |
| RoHS Status | ROHS3 Compliant |
| Moisture Sensitivity Level (MSL) | 1 (Unlimited) |
| REACH Status | REACH Unaffected |
Substitute Part Grouping Explanation
Substitution eligibility for the 5652F1-5V is determined by the following critical parameters:
Mandatory Matching Parameters:
- Voltage Rating: 5V
- Lens Size: 3mm, T-1
- Mounting Type: Through Hole, Right Angle
- Configuration: Single
- Color: Red
- Lens Type: Diffused, Tinted
- Lens Style: Round with Domed Top
Allowable Variation Parameters:
- Current: 12-13mA range acceptable
- Wavelength - Peak: 635-655nm range acceptable
- Millicandela Rating: 8-9mcd range acceptable
- Viewing Angle: Specification provided or unspecified acceptable
The SSF-LXH103ID-5V from Lumex Opto/Components Inc. meets all mandatory matching parameters and operates within allowable variation ranges for current, wavelength, and brightness output.
Parameter Comparison
| Parameter | 5652F1-5V (VCC) | SSF-LXH103ID-5V (Lumex) | Compatibility |
|---|---|---|---|
| Voltage Rating | 5V | 5V | Match |
| Color | Red | Red | Match |
| Configuration | Single | Single | Match |
| Current | 13mA | 12mA | Compatible (within 1mA) |
| Wavelength - Peak | 655nm | 635nm | Compatible (20nm variation) |
| Millicandela Rating | 8mcd | 9mcd | Compatible (1mcd higher) |
| Viewing Angle | Not specified | 80° | Substitute provides specification |
| Lens Type | Diffused, Tinted | Diffused, Tinted | Match |
| Lens Style | Round with Domed Top | Round with Domed Top | Match |
| Lens Size | 3mm, T-1 | 3mm, T-1 | Match |
| Mounting Type | Through Hole, Right Angle | Through Hole, Right Angle | Match |
| RoHS Status | ROHS3 Compliant | ROHS3 Compliant | Match |
| Moisture Sensitivity Level (MSL) | 1 (Unlimited) | 1 (Unlimited) | Match |
| REACH Status | REACH Unaffected | REACH Unaffected | Match |
| Product Status | Obsolete | Active | Substitute is active production |
Engineering Selection Recommendations
The SSF-LXH103ID-5V from Lumex Opto/Components Inc. is qualified as a direct substitute for the obsolete 5652F1-5V based on the following engineering criteria:
Compliance & Regulatory Alignment: Both components maintain ROHS3 compliance and REACH unaffected status, ensuring regulatory continuity in applications subject to environmental and hazardous substance restrictions.
Functional Equivalence: The substitute part maintains identical voltage rating (5V), mounting configuration (through-hole, right-angle), and optical characteristics (3mm T-1 diffused red lens with domed top). Operating current differential of 1mA and wavelength variation of 20nm fall within acceptable engineering tolerances for circuit board indicator applications.
Supply Chain Advantage: The SSF-LXH103ID-5V is classified as active product status with documented inventory availability (697 pcs), providing reliable sourcing compared to the obsolete 5652F1-5V.
Brightness Enhancement: The substitute delivers 9mcd output compared to 8mcd in the original part, providing improved visibility without requiring circuit redesign.
Frequently Asked Questions (FAQ)
Q: Can the SSF-LXH103ID-5V be used as a direct replacement in existing PCB designs for the 5652F1-5V?
A: Yes. Both components share identical mounting type (through-hole, right-angle), lens size (3mm T-1), and voltage rating (5V). PCB footprints and circuit connections are compatible without modification.
Q: What is the significance of the 1mA current difference between the two parts?
A: The 5652F1-5V operates at 13mA while the SSF-LXH103ID-5V operates at 12mA. This 1mA reduction results in lower power consumption and reduced heat generation. Existing current-limiting resistor values in the circuit will continue to function within acceptable operating parameters.
Q: How does the wavelength difference (655nm vs. 635nm) affect visual appearance?
A: Both wavelengths are within the red spectrum. The 635nm wavelength in the substitute produces a slightly more orange-tinted red compared to the 655nm original. For diffused, tinted lens applications, this variation is not visually distinguishable in typical circuit board indicator use cases.
Q: Are there any compliance or certification differences between these parts?
A: No. Both components are ROHS3 compliant, REACH unaffected, and carry identical environmental classification (MSL 1 - Unlimited). Regulatory and compliance requirements are fully maintained with the substitute part.
Q: What is the advantage of the 80° viewing angle specification on the substitute?
A: The original 5652F1-5V does not specify a viewing angle parameter. The SSF-LXH103ID-5V provides documented 80° viewing angle, offering design engineers explicit optical performance data for applications requiring defined visibility zones.
Q: Is the higher brightness (9mcd vs. 8mcd) of the substitute part a concern?
A: No. The 1mcd increase in brightness is a performance enhancement. For circuit board indicator applications, increased luminous intensity improves visibility without introducing compatibility issues. No circuit modifications are required.
